Regarding the Bock Honda dealership being built in Westford that Eric and Mairo wrote
about-----

I (an Acton resident) am willing to meet with the Westford Assistant Town Manager if some
Westford resident is also willing to be part of this meeting.  

I spoke with Steve Ledoux today (he is the current Acton TM and previously was the
Westford TM up to January of this year), and he suggested that either the Westford ATM or
the Planning Department head would be good choices to talk with.  He mentioned that the
Planning board could put restrictions on the Honda dealership permit, even though Westford
doesn't have any LP ordinance.
